Pellionia repens
Pellionia repens (Lour.) Merr.
Description
Pellionia repens, commonly known as the trailing watermelon begonia, is a perennial herbaceous plant belonging to the Urticaceae family. Despite its taxonomic classification, this species is cultivated primarily for its ornamental foliage, characterized by unique variegated patterns and a creeping growth habit that makes it highly desirable for indoor landscapes.
The plant originates from the tropical regions of Southeast Asia, specifically inhabiting the understory of dense rainforests. Its natural distribution spans across Vietnam, China, and Malaysia. In these native environments, it thrives in consistently high humidity, shaded conditions, and nutrient-rich, decaying leaf litter, which defines its specific cultural requirements in cultivation.
Botanically, Pellionia repens is distinguished by its succulent, trailing stems that readily root at the nodes. The leaves are asymmetrical, typically featuring an attractive blend of olive-green and bronze-maroon pigments. Agricultural requirements for successful production include a well-draining, peat-based potting medium that maintains slight acidity. The plant demands a consistently moist environment but remains highly susceptible to root decay if the substrate becomes waterlogged. Temperature management is crucial; the plant should ideally be kept in a climate ranging from 18°C to 24°C, avoiding cold drafts at all costs.
In commercial and amateur cultivation, the plant is valued for its versatility in ornamental arrangements. While generally robust, growers must remain vigilant against typical plant pathogens and pests to ensure aesthetic quality:
- Botrytis blight under conditions of poor air circulation.
- Spider mite infestations, especially in low-humidity environments.
- Root rot caused by overwatering or poor drainage systems.
- Foliar chlorosis due to improper pH levels in the growing medium.
